Günter Nimtz is a scholar working on Atomic and Molecular Physics, and Optics,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Günter Nimtz has authored 32 papers receiving a total of 746 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Atomic and Molecular Physics, and Optics, 7 papers in Electrical and Electronic Engineering and 6 papers in Materials Chemistry. Recurrent topics in Günter Nimtz’s work include Quantum optics and atomic interactions (13 papers), Quantum Mechanics and Applications (6 papers) and Cold Atom Physics and Bose-Einstein Condensates (5 papers). Günter Nimtz is often cited by papers focused on Quantum optics and atomic interactions (13 papers), Quantum Mechanics and Applications (6 papers) and Cold Atom Physics and Bose-Einstein Condensates (5 papers). Günter Nimtz collaborates with scholars based in Germany and Austria. Günter Nimtz's co-authors include Ralf Dornhaus, B. Schlicht, P Marquardt, Rolf R. Gerhardts, Karlheinz Seeger, W. Richter, Reiner Zorn, Ulrich Walter, Oswald Lockhoff and Dietrich Stauffer and has published in prestigious journals such as Science, Physical Review Letters and Applied Physics Letters.
